:root{--bg: #F5F0E8;--surface: #FFFFFF;--surface-warm: #F0EAE0;--border: #E2D8CC;--border-light: #EAE4DA;--text-primary: #1C1208;--text-secondary: #5A4730;--text-muted: #9A8570;--espresso: #2A1300;--copper: #B56B30;--copper-light: #D4946A;--cream: #EDE0CA;--done-bg: #E6F0E2;--done-fg: #2D6628;--next-bg: #FEF3E0;--next-fg: #905208;--shadow-xs: 0 1px 2px rgba(42,19,0,.05);--shadow-sm: 0 2px 8px rgba(42,19,0,.07), 0 1px 2px rgba(42,19,0,.04);--shadow-md: 0 4px 16px rgba(42,19,0,.09), 0 2px 4px rgba(42,19,0,.04);--shadow-lg: 0 12px 32px rgba(42,19,0,.12), 0 4px 8px rgba(42,19,0,.05);--radius-sm: 8px;--radius-md: 12px;--radius-lg: 16px;--radius-xl: 20px;--font-sans: "Inter", system-ui, -apple-system, sans-serif;--font-serif: "EB Garamond", Georgia, "Times New Roman", serif}@media (hover: hover){*{cursor:none!important}button:not(:disabled):hover{filter:brightness(.88);transition:filter .12s ease}a:hover{opacity:.75;transition:opacity .12s ease}tr:hover td{background:#b56b300f;transition:background .12s ease}select:hover{filter:brightness(.94);transition:filter .12s ease}}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body{font-family:var(--font-sans);background:var(--bg);color:var(--text-primary);line-height:1.6;min-height:100vh}button{font-family:var(--font-sans);cursor:pointer;border:none;outline:none;background:none}input,select,textarea{font-family:var(--font-sans)}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:var(--border);border-radius:99px}::-webkit-scrollbar-thumb:hover{background:var(--text-muted)}.card-hover{transition:transform .2s ease,box-shadow .2s ease}.card-hover:hover{transform:translateY(-2px);box-shadow:var(--shadow-md)}@keyframes bob{0%,to{transform:translate(-50%) translateY(0);opacity:.28}50%{transform:translate(-50%) translateY(6px);opacity:.5}}@keyframes mapPulse{0%{r:8;opacity:.35}70%{r:18;opacity:0}to{r:8;opacity:0}}@keyframes steam-a{0%{transform:translateY(0) translate(0) scaleX(1);opacity:0}8%{opacity:.92}50%{transform:translateY(-110px) translate(18px) scaleX(2.2);opacity:.65}to{transform:translateY(-220px) translate(-8px) scaleX(1.2);opacity:0}}@keyframes steam-b{0%{transform:translateY(0) translate(0) scaleX(1);opacity:0}8%{opacity:.85}50%{transform:translateY(-95px) translate(-20px) scaleX(2);opacity:.55}to{transform:translateY(-200px) translate(12px) scaleX(1);opacity:0}}@keyframes steam-c{0%{transform:translateY(0) translate(0) scaleX(1);opacity:0}8%{opacity:.88}50%{transform:translateY(-120px) translate(8px) scaleX(2.5);opacity:.6}to{transform:translateY(-240px) translate(-14px) scaleX(1.4);opacity:0}}.card-spotlight{position:relative;overflow:hidden;--mouse-x: 50%;--mouse-y: 50%;--spotlight-color: rgba(255, 255, 255, .05)}.card-spotlight: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:radial-gradient(circle at var(--mouse-x) var(--mouse-y),var(--spotlight-color),transparent 80%);opacity:0;transition:opacity .4s ease;pointer-events:none}.card-spotlight:hover:before{opacity:1}.counter-container{position:relative;display:inline-block}.counter-counter{display:flex;overflow:hidden;line-height:1}.counter-digit{position:relative;width:1ch;font-variant-numeric:tabular-nums}.counter-number{position:absolute;top:0;right:0;bottom:0;left:0;display:flex;align-items:center;justify-content:center}.gradient-container{pointer-events:none;position:absolute;top:0;bottom:0;left:0;right:0}.top-gradient{position:absolute;top:0;width:100%}.bottom-gradient{position:absolute;bottom:0;width:100%}
